Could use a trim of about 40 minutes, and the ending (though realistic) makes you want to throw something at the screen, but for much of the time this is a sturdy socially-conscious drama in the mold of John Sayles. The lead actor even looks like a Tunisian David Strathairn. The show is stolen by Hafsia Herzi's gutsy performance though.
